Can you pop your eyeball out of your head? Globe luxation is the medical term for when an eyeball protrudes or “pops” out of the eye socket. By Anna Barden. Globe luxation is the medical term for when an eyeball protrudes or "pops" out of the eye socket. This rare condition can happen spontaneously or occur due to head or eye trauma. Some systemic health conditions, such as floppy eyelid syndrome and thyroid eye disease, can also increase the risk … See more Globe luxation may occur spontaneously because of an underlying condition or due to head- or eye-related trauma. See more Globe luxation can occur with or without severing the optic nerveor other eye muscles.
